The System Engineering Co-op student will work alongside, and in support of the Systems Engineering team. The system engineering team is a diverse, collaborative group working on the support and/or development of medical devices used to automate in-vitro diagnostic testing usually found in a microbiology laboratory. The engineering co-op student will be supervised by and mentored by the Director, Manager, and Senior engineers within the System Engineering team and the role will include a significant amount of interaction and collaboration with other system development team members. Primary Duties The co-op student will obtain basic knowledge related to medical instrumentation research, design, development, and testing. Candidates will be expected to have general engineering knowledge including the use of standard engineering practices. This position will include creation and execution of verification tests, troubleshooting, diagnosing, and evaluating instrument and system issues and design alternatives. The co-op student will be given the opportunity to acquire knowledge and understanding of the bioMérieux Design Control process that addresses US and international regulatory requirements, as well as internal Quality requirements.
